Second miner found dead after Slovenia coal mine accident
- A second miner was found dead on Wednesday after an accident at the Velenje coal mine in northeastern Slovenia, according to STA News Agency.
- Rescuers are still searching for a third miner trapped in the mine after hundreds of tons of slurry collapsed into the tunnels.
- The rescue mission involves about 80 rescuers and is risky due to manual debris removal, as reported by mine officials.
- Production at the mine has been halted and will resume after the rescue mission is completed, stated Prime Minister Robert Golob.
